It’s just that people are assholes and we are all tired of assholes ruling the world while also knowing we cannot do a damn thing about it. Nothing. Nada. Zero. Zilch. Except fantasize about their demise in various ways. The problem with death metal, in general, is that so many of us wear the hate, it’s a crowded space. How do you stand out in the death metal scene? Well, you have to be creative. Duh. You have to write great songs consistently. Most of all, you need to be unique.
It turns out Ageless Oblivion have most of this down, but not all. Their debut, Temples Of Transcendent Evolution, is a respectable effort with many strengths. However, I’m just not convinced they are memorable enough to stand out any more than most other modern death metal acts. That doesn’t meant I didn’t like it. In fact, I quite like this album.
The album is almost an EP with seven tracks plus a fancy-pants intro of ambient noise. Eight tracks is not enough sustain my metal appetite. I really felt like I wanted more from the band. Ageless Oblivion could have added at least two more tracks. I like my albums fat, especially when most of what I’m hearing is good.
But enough of that negative shit. Ageless Oblivion are technically proficient at your standard laying to waste all of humanity. Forests are wiped out, bodies of water burn, and populations turn to ashes. Temples of Transcendent Evolution passes all of those tests in our labs. There are plenty of mega-riffs and double bass to satisfy every tortured soul. This is because, according to their press release, the band’s members have roots from the band, Arkane. They cite such influences as Neurosis, Cult Of Luna, and Akercocke. Solid.
Thematically, Ageless Oblivion focus on more epic fantasy stories. They are an obvious choice for late night RPG sessions with your other dateless friends. But more than that, the band creates an atmosphere that is dark, dangerous, and also enticing. “Drone of the Nychomist” is probably my favorite track from the album just because of the incredible guitar work and interesting hooks.
One thing I particularly enjoyed about this album was low-end spectrum captured in the recording. You have not lived until you pimp your ride and blast this album through an MTX Jackhammer subwoofer. I haven’t heard such great bass thump from a metal album in a long time. And keep this in mind: I just have the record company’s MP3s. I can’t imagine how good this sounds lossless. I get chills just thinking about it.
There are so many death metal bands out there. Ageless Oblivion has the potential to stand out, but they aren’t quite there yet. They need a little more variety in their song structures (think: Revocation or Godslave) as well as a little polish in their song writing. However, I will give them credit: they created one hell of a debut. More please.
